The Effect of Substrate Volume on the Catalytic Behavior of Pd/Rh Three-Way Catalysts
In this paper,Pd/Rh series catalyst substrate samples were prepared at the same cell density,with different volume.The fresh catalyst was aged.And Catalyst test by light-off factor (LOF).The results tested demonstrated that,for the same cell density of substrate,the increase of substrate volume benefited to obtain lower light-off temperature.It was effective measurement that higher cell density enlarged the operating window of catalyst.When the volume of substrate increased by 40%,catalyst light-off temperature decreased 5-10℃,the range of the air-fuel ratio is enlarged in 0.43.And it is role equivalent to the density of the cell density in additive quantity of 50% or Pd/Rh in additive quantity of 20%.
